Posts

Showing posts from November, 2017

Ex Machina (2015) 's Review

Image
From the beginning of this film, which is how humans can't be escaped from the name of Technology. Yes, modern humans today certainly can't be escaped from laptops, smartphones, and other things related to technology. In this film where a boss named Nathan intends to create an interface that can help people make their work easier. We all know if making an interface is not easy. In this case, the computer and its equipment must be designed in accordance with the desired needs and can help humans in their daily work (according to specific tasks given). If we talk about interfaces, it will offend the User Interface. User Interface here is more than what humans can see, touch or hear. The user interface includes concepts, user needs to know computer systems, and must be integrated into the entire system. The user interface isn't enough to just look 'good' but must be able to support tasks done by humans and has made to avoid minor mistakes. In this film, it c

Sejarah dan Perkembangan Sistem Informasi

Sejarah dan Perkembangan Sistem Informasi Manusia mulai berbagi informasi antara mereka sejak dahulu kala, sekitar 3000 tahun sebelum masehi atau jika dihitung sudah lebih dari 5000 tahun yang lalu. Cara berbagi informasi itu adalah dengan menuliskannya pada batu, kayu, papirus, atau tanah liat. Awal sejarah perkembangan sistem informasi dimulai dari sini. Tanpa langkah yang dilakukan oleh manusia kuno ini, tidak akan ada perangkat teknologi canggih seperti komputer dan telepon seluler. Setidaknya ada 4 tahapan yang dilalui dalam perkembangan komunikasi dan informasi, di antaranya akan saya jelaskan di bawah ini. Periode Pertama  (Pra Mekanik) Pada periode ini, komunikasi menggunakan simbol untuk menyampaikan informasi. Pada tahun 3000-2000 sebelum masehi, manusia menggunakan gambar juga untuk menyampaikan pesan. Contohnya adalah bangsa Fenisia yang mendiami Timur Tengah (Lebanon) menciptakan model yang sama. Bangsa Yunani Kuno mengadaptasi simbol milik bangsa Fenisia de

Software Development Life Cycle (SDLC)

Image
   Pada awal pengembangan software atau perangkat lunak, biasanya programmer langsung melakukan kegiatan utamanya yakni pengkodean software dengan menggunakan prosedur atau pengembangan software. Tentunya dalam pembuatan software tersebut, seorang programmer akan menemukan kendala-kendala yang seiring dengan perkembangan lingkup system yang semakin meluas. Oleh karena itu dibutuhkan proses dalam pengembangan software dengan model dan metodologi yang disebut dengan SDLC (Software Development Life Cycle / System Development Life Cycle.       A.      Tahapan SDLC Seperti halnya proses metamorphosis pada kupu-kupu yang indah, maka dibutuhkan beberapa tahapan yang harus dapat dilalui agar menghasilkan software yang berkualitas sehingga user atau client merasa puas. Saya bahas tahapan-tahapan yang ada pada SDLC secara umum sebagai berikut : 1.        Inisialisasi (Initiation) Tahap ini biasanya ditandai dengan pembuatan proposal proyek perangkat lunak /software yang akan di